mirror of
https://github.com/amd/blis.git
synced 2026-04-20 07:38:53 +00:00
Armv8 Trash New Bulk Kernels
- They didn't make much improvements. - Can't register row-preferral and column-preferral ukrs at the same time. Will break 1m.
This commit is contained in:
@@ -50,7 +50,7 @@ void bli_cntx_init_firestorm( cntx_t* cntx )
|
||||
(
|
||||
2,
|
||||
BLIS_GEMM_UKR, BLIS_FLOAT, bli_sgemm_armv8a_asm_8x12, FALSE,
|
||||
BLIS_GEMM_UKR, BLIS_DOUBLE, bli_dgemm_armv8a_asm_6x8r, TRUE,
|
||||
BLIS_GEMM_UKR, BLIS_DOUBLE, bli_dgemm_armv8a_asm_6x8, FALSE,
|
||||
cntx
|
||||
);
|
||||
|
||||
|
||||
@@ -39,9 +39,9 @@ PACKM_KER_PROT( double, d, packm_armv8a_int_8xk )
|
||||
|
||||
GEMM_UKR_PROT( float, s, gemm_armv8a_asm_8x12 )
|
||||
GEMM_UKR_PROT( double, d, gemm_armv8a_asm_6x8 )
|
||||
GEMM_UKR_PROT( double, d, gemm_armv8a_asm_6x8r )
|
||||
GEMM_UKR_PROT( double, d, gemm_armv8a_asm_8x4 )
|
||||
GEMM_UKR_PROT( double, d, gemm_armv8a_asm_4x4 )
|
||||
// GEMM_UKR_PROT( double, d, gemm_armv8a_asm_6x8r )
|
||||
// GEMM_UKR_PROT( double, d, gemm_armv8a_asm_8x4 )
|
||||
// GEMM_UKR_PROT( double, d, gemm_armv8a_asm_4x4 )
|
||||
|
||||
GEMMSUP_KER_PROT( double, d, gemmsup_rd_armv8a_asm_6x8n )
|
||||
GEMMSUP_KER_PROT( double, d, gemmsup_rd_armv8a_asm_6x8m )
|
||||
|
||||
Reference in New Issue
Block a user